Like streaming platforms like Netflix, Amazon or Star Plus, this system is gaining more and more ground in the automotive industry.
Car leasing, widely recognized on the Old Continent and in the United States, is gaining ground in Chile, a system that works in the same way as the popular streaming platforms, that is, by subscription. Thanks to this, it is possible to rent latest generation vehicles with a simple click, paying a monthly subscription and without the need for an initial investment.
Currently, Chileans are learning and adapting to new realities, one of them being that of the automotive sector through rental, a form of mobility that seeks to revolutionize the way we acquire and enjoy vehicles.

This is not a minor fact. In Spain, for example, about 30% of the vehicle registry goes through this route, so in our country they consider it very favorably or, at least, as an option when changing cars.
In Chile there is already a small variety to choose from this system, companies like NexCar, Smartycar and Tripp are adding subscribers. The whole process is simple to complete, it can be done online and you can also request that your chosen car be left at your doorstep.
The advantages of this system are the delivery of the car without the need to pay a cent at the start of the contract and it pays particular attention to flexibility, allowing users to choose a vehicle of the year with all the services associates included, such as maintenance. , insurance, taxes, permits, licenses, tire changes for normal wear and availability of a replacement car.
Nexcar is one of those companies that promise not to have additional expenses, to constantly renew the 100% digital vehicle, not to make a large investment and the user will only have to take care of gasoline and of the label.
One thing that stands out about this company is that its entire vehicle fleet is monitored via GPS and electric cutters, allowing for greater control and reducing the risk of theft.

The options that exist at Nexcar include brands such as Audi, Changan, Chevrolet, Great Wall, JAC, Mazda, Nissan, Renault, Seat Skoda, Suzuki and Volkswagen. Their prices range from 262,000 pesos and can easily exceed a million pesos.
Smarty Car is another company that offers this service, where you can easily find a wide variety of vehicles. In it, you will have electric and hybrid units available at values starting from $420,000 per month for a city car and from $650,000 for an SUV, including license, insurance and maintenance. The company already has more than a dozen users nationwide, reaping the benefits of a model that seeks to lower barriers to entry to low- or zero-emissions technology.
“We have a major challenge: integrating environmentally friendly vehicles, thus simplifying the mobility transition for our customers. For this, we are working to have, by the end of this year, an availability of electric and hybrid vehicles that reaches 10% of our offer, which means having 10% of our subscriptions in this segment by the end of 2024.” , said Benjamín Salineros, CEO of Smartycar.
The conditions for subscribing are to be over 21 years old, to have a driving license, to have a positive financial background and that the monthly payment for the vehicle to be subscribed does not exceed 20% of the user’s monthly income.
Take for example, if you go to their website you will find the ECO line with models such as the Maple 30X (100% electric vehicle) with installments starting from 497,000 pesos, the DS3 Crossback E-Tens for payments of 578,000 pesos. per month and even the Kia Niro EV, yes, this vehicle has a price of over a million.

On the other hand, you also have more premium options, which they call “Black”, where you can find vehicles like the Audi Q3, Mercedes Benz A200, Volkswagen Atlas, among others. The top model is the Audi e-tron sportback, which achieves a range of 453 kilometers (thanks to a high-voltage battery).

They also offer semi-new lines such as Kia Morning, Chevrolet Onix, Opel Corsa, Renault Clio, among others. Finally, there is the option that is increasingly taking center stage, such as pick-ups, which stand out in its catalog with the Chevrolet Silverado, the Volkswagen Amarok and the Voltera R6.
